A gram (g) measures weight or mass, while a milliliter (ml) measures volume. The key difference is that grams indicate how much something weighs, whereas milliliters indicate how much space a liquid takes up. Knowing this helps in accurate measurement in cooking and science.

FAQs & Answers

  1. Can grams be converted to milliliters? Grams measure mass while milliliters measure volume, so direct conversion depends on the substance's density.
  2. Why is it important to know the difference between grams and milliliters? Knowing the difference ensures accurate measurements in recipes and scientific experiments, preventing errors.
  3. Which unit should I use for cooking liquids? Milliliters are best for measuring liquids as they indicate volume, whereas grams measure weight.
